It is a compilation of letters that former US President Ronald Reagan wrote to his wife, Nancy Reagan.  I am a sucker for love letters and sweet short notes. Kahit sa used paper or sa chocolate wrapper pa yan nakasulat, okay lang! hahaha.  In this day and age when it's easier to just send an email message, SMS; or post a message on one's Facebook wall, or tweet someone, I really appreciate getting hand-written letters, cards and notes.  Iba pa din ang may personal touch (ang cheesy! hehe).      

Below are some excerpts from the book:

"Darling Mommie Poo, 

Feb.14 may be the date they observe and call Valentine's Day, but that is for people of only ordinary luck. I happen to have a 
Valentine's life, which started on March 4, 1952, and will continue as long as I have you."

"Dear First Mommie, I'm in Wyoming, Montana - or Nevada depending on what time you read this. But I'll be at Camp David at 9:15 p.m. Friday night. I'll be glad to see you. I miss you - even when I'm asleep. This is a very lonesome place when you are some place else."

"Dear First Lady, As President of the U.S., it is my honor and privilege to cite you for service above and beyond the call of duty in that you have made one man (me) the most happy man in the world for 29 years."

It is hard to stay calm and composed when faced with a situation when fighting back and being rude were an easier option. I'm sooooooooo happy I kept calm and I carried on (I'm so happy, can you count the 'Os'? Hehehe).  Just to give you a quick background, Keep Calm and Carry On was a poster produced by the Government of the United Kingdom in 1939 during the beginning of the Second World War, intended to raise the morale of the of British Public in the event of invasion (Source: Wikipedia).
